Human resources is no exception. One of the main documents in its paperwork is considered a work book. All entries in it must be kept in a strictly defined manner. For this, an Instruction for filling out work books was developed. It was approved in 2003 by the Russian Ministry of Labor and replaced the document that had been in force in the Soviet Union since 1973.
Instructions for filling out work books determine the procedure by which all work books, the enclosed leaflets, and also duplicates issued in exchange for lost documents must be executed. This manual explains how to make a record.
Instructions for filling out work books include 7 parts. The first includes a general description of the form of the work book and all its sections, and also explains how and by what records are made in it. The second part is devoted to the correct filling of the cover page of this form. This is usually done with the primary job application.
In the process of work, a person can receive a new education or profession, change his last name, first name or patronymic. All these data are accurately recorded on the cover page, and the documents on the basis of which the corresponding records are made are indicated on the inside of the cover. The following two sections contain information about the work of a citizen and his reward for his success.
Instructions for filling out work books pay special attention to entering data on the dismissal of an employee. The fifth and sixth parts of it are devoted to this. According to the legislation of the Russian Federation, termination of labor relations is carried out under article 77 of the Labor Code. 11 points of this article clearly delineate the reasons for dismissal. Therefore, when making the relevant entries in the workbook, it is necessary, in addition to the article itself, to indicate also the paragraph of the article of the Labor Code, in accordance with which the dismissal of a particular employee is made.
The last part of the manual contains information on filling out a
duplicate work book. It clearly describes when and to whom such a duplicate is issued, and also explains the rules for entering information about the employee.
This Instruction is a kind of labor book rules. An incorrect entry may deprive a person of the right to certain benefits and thereby violate his rights. Every specialist in the personnel department must know these rules thoroughly in order to correctly apply them in practice.
The instructions for maintaining labor books contain not only the rules for making entries in them. It is directly consistent with the Labor Code, article 66 of which states that the employer must have a workbook for each employee if he has worked for more than five days at the enterprise. Admission data must be entered in his workbook, and the book itself is registered in the Traffic Registration Book of the corresponding forms. And it doesnโt matter at all whether a citizen works in any organization or with an individual entrepreneur. The law is one for all.
